E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
blockHandler
服务降级(Sentinel)
注解方式实现,必要的依赖必须引入以及切面Bean接口代码@RequestMapping("/degrade")@SentinelResource(value=DEGRADE_RESOURCE_NAME,
blockHandler
菜是一种态度
·
2024-02-14 06:54
sentinel
java
服务降级
springcloud
Sentinel之力:解锁@SentinelResource注解的神奇威力
`
blockHandler
`属性:2.`fall
一只牛博
·
2024-02-02 18:47
#
sentinel
sentinel
java
开发语言
微服务:Sentinel之 @SentinelResource 注解
@SentinelResource注解包含以下属性:value:资源名称,必需项(不能为空)entryType:entry类型,可选项(默认为EntryType.OUT)
blockHandler
/
blockHandler
半盏星空
·
2023-11-11 09:52
微服务:Spring
Cloud
Alibaba
java
spring
cloud
微服务
spring
boot
十五、Sentinel实现限流降级(2)
文章目录一、降级规则1.基本介绍1.1进一步说明1.2复习Hystrix2.降级策略实战2.1RT是什么2.2异常比例2.3熔断数二、@SentinelResource1.兜底方法2.value属性测试3.
blockHandler
4
夏天秃头之路
·
2023-11-04 10:54
spring
cloud
SpringCloud-Sentinel
一、介绍(1)提供界面配置配置服务限流、服务降级、服务熔断(2)@SentinelResource的
blockHandler
只处理后台配置的异常,运行时异常fallBack处理,且资源名为value时才生效
qq_25243147
·
2023-10-20 08:02
SpringCloud
spring
cloud
sentinel
spring
com.alibaba.csp.sentinel.slots.block.flow.FlowException: null
1、我们定义的
blockHandler
限流方法参数没有加BlockException,放在末尾2、
blockHandler
限流方法返回值和业务方法返回值不一致注意:限流回调方法XXXBlockHandler
白鸽呀
·
2023-10-11 23:08
SpringCloud分布式
微服务
com.alibaba.csp.sentinel.slots.block.flow.FlowException
检查兜底方法的返回值是否和资源方法一致2.检查兜底方法的参数是否和资源方法一致,并且兜底方法的最后一个参数要是BlockExceptionex3.检查兜底方法名是否和@SentinelResource注解的
blockHandler
rucheng1
·
2023-10-11 23:08
sentinel
使用sentinelResource报com.alibaba.csp.sentinel.slots.block.flow.FlowException: null
问题:在使用@SentinelResource中的
blockHandler
时,一直报:com.alibaba.csp.sentinel.slots.block.flow.FlowException:null
冷冷清清中的风风火火
·
2023-10-11 23:37
java
Caused by: com.alibaba.csp.sentinel.slots.block.flow.FlowException: null
做限流的时候,报了这个错:原代码如下:@ServicepublicclassSentinelService{@SentinelResource(value="SentinelService.success",
blockHandler
半路出家的码农小王
·
2023-10-11 23:31
微服务
微服务
Spring Cloud Alibaba Sentinel流量防卫兵
分布式遇到的问题2.解决的方法Sentinel:分布式系统的流量防卫兵1.简介和特折Sentinel流量防卫兵的搭建1.引入依赖2.添加配置类3.运行类上添加@SentinelResource,并配置
blockHandler
微风轻吟挽歌
·
2023-09-24 07:49
sentinel
SentinelResource保护资源
RequestMapping("/test")publicclassTestController{@GetMapping(value="/hello")@SentinelResource(value="hello",
blockHandler
yicj
·
2023-09-23 21:59
java
spring
Sentinel实战应用
介绍1.2Sentinel核心功能1.2.1流量控制1.2.2熔断降级1.3Sentinel熔断限流1.3.1SpringBoot集成1.3.1.1@SentinelResource注解1.3.1.2
blockHandler
1.3.1.3fallback1.3.1.4defaultFallback1.3
Ybb_studyRecord
·
2023-09-20 23:18
互联网微服务前沿技术栈进阶
sentinel
spring
java
sentinel集成
sentinel控制台
sentinel1.8.6中的
blockHandler
/blockHandlerClass和fallback/fallbackClass
官网介绍简单的说
blockHandler
/blockHandlerClass是给限流降级用的,异常为BlockException,fallback/fallbackClass是给除BlockException
gsls200808
·
2023-09-10 02:32
sentinel
blockHandler
fallback
Sentinel配置的
blockHandler
方法不生效
①首先配置流控的资源名跟@SentinelResource中的Value配置的一定要一直且唯一②其次
blockhandler
后面的方法一定要跟下面指定的方法名称是一样的③也就是我犯下的错误,一定要注意是上面那个才是
叶孤崖
·
2023-09-05 01:44
sentinel
sentinel
blockHandler
不生效
sentinelblockHandler不生效:packageorg.bc.sentinel.controller;importcom.alibaba.csp.sentinel.annotation.SentinelResource;importcom.alibaba.csp.sentinel.slots.block.BlockException;importorg.apache.commons.
码农-004
·
2023-09-04 21:59
读书笔记
sentinel
Sentinel的
blockHandler
与fallback的区别
一、两者区别这里说明一下,笔者使用的是Alibaba的Sentinel限流降级框架,Sentinel提供了限流、服务降级功能,但是只是限制后,返回不可控的结果肯定是不行的,我们还要保证调用者在调用那些被限制的服务时候,不管是不是被限制,都要让他们拿到一个合理的结果,而不是扔回去一个异常就完事了。Sentinel提供了这样的功能,让我们可以另外定义一个方法来代替被限制或异常服务返回数据,这就是fal
ximeneschen
·
2023-08-11 18:30
SpringCloud
编码技巧——Sentinel的
blockHandler
与fallback
本文介绍Sentinel的
blockHandler
与fallback的区别,背景是:发生限流时,配置的sentinel的
blockhandler
没有生效而fallback生效了;排查原因,从而给出Sentinel
七海健人
·
2023-08-11 18:00
代码技巧
sentinel
blockHandler
fallback
限流
降级
docker安装sentinel,sentinel常用操作
sentinelwindows运行sentineljava-Dserver.port=8858-jarsentinel-dashboard-1.8.0.jarsentinel常用操作1.qps流控、线程池流控//
blockHandler
Andy_Health
·
2023-08-10 04:23
微服务
docker
Spring Cloud Alibaba【授权规则、系统自适应限流、SentinelResource注解配置详解之只配 置fallback】(八)
目录分布式流量防护_授权规则分布式流量防护_系统自适应限流分布式流量防护_SentinelResource注解配置详解之只配置fallback分布式流量防护_SentinelResource配置详解之只配置
blockHandler
童小纯
·
2023-07-25 01:42
Spring全家桶
wpf
Spring
Cloud
java
Spring Cloud Alibaba【实时监控数据、Sentinel为什么需要持久化 、Sentinel组件二次开发、认识本地事物 、事务的四大特性ACID】(九)
目录分布式流量防护_SentinelResource配置详解之fallback和
blockHandler
都配置分布式流量防护_实时监控数据分布式流量防护_Sentinel为什么需要持久化分布式流量防护_
童小纯
·
2023-07-24 23:59
Spring全家桶
wpf
Spring
Cloud
java
SpringCloud Alibaba-Sentinel
Sentinel核心库1.1Sentinel介绍1.2Sentinel核心功能1.2.1流量控制1.2.2熔断降级2Sentinel限流熔断降级2.1@SentinelResource定义资源2.1.1
blockHandler
Allen-xs
·
2023-06-19 23:34
微服务
spring
cloud
sentinel
java
Sentinel服务
Sentinel2,引入依赖spring-cloud-starter-alibaba-sentinel3,自定义资源,添加注解:@SentinelResource(value="getByCode",
blockHandler
阿杰技术
·
2023-04-21 11:42
微服务
sentinel
java
开发语言
七、Sentinel的注解@SentinelResource详细介绍
文章目录@SentinelResource注解自定义限流处理逻辑具体逻辑fallback函数同时配置
blockHandler
和fallback属性exceptionsToIgnore属性@SentinelResource
竹峰的风
·
2023-04-03 08:40
Sentinel
sentinel
后端
微服务
spring
cloud
sentinel的@SentinelResource注解详解
@SentinelResource注解包含以下属性:value:资源名称,必需项(不能为空)entryType:entry类型,可选项(默认为EntryType.OUT)
blockHandler
/blockHandlerClass
wangjinb
·
2022-12-28 11:23
sentinel
服务降级
java
spring
SpringCloud-Sentinel的@SentinelResource注解(Day14)
value:资源名称,必需项(不能为空entryType:entry类型,可选项(默认为EntryType.OUT)
blockHandler
/blockHandlerClass:
blockHandler
临水而愚
·
2022-12-28 11:19
SpringCloud
java
开发语言
后端
sentinel - @SentinelResource注解使用-1
blockHandler
,fallback参数使用
@SentinelResource属性介绍Value:资源名称,必需项(不能为空)
blockHandler
:处理BlockException的函数名称(可以理解对Sentinel的配置进行方法兜底)。
小哇666
·
2022-12-28 11:48
#
SpringCloud
spring
cloud
sentinel
Sentinel笔记(五)@SentinelResource注解
如何在项目中添加Sentinel的支持请看这里Sentinel笔记(一)第一个监控实例文章目录系统自适应限流@SentinelResource注解value属性
blockHandler
/blockHandlerClassblockHandler
多冷啊、我在东北玩泥巴
·
2022-12-28 11:45
学习笔记
java
分布式
sentinel的@SentinelResource注解使用
ExceptionUtil类用于自定义限流处理逻辑自定义限流处理类:ExceptionUtil二:新增@SentinelResource注解配置@SentinelResource(value=“hello2”,
blockHandler
杭州小哥哥
·
2022-12-28 11:36
SpringCloud
Sentinel
Spring Cloud Alibaba 系列之 Sentinel @SentinelResource 注解
我们可以使用@SentinelResource注解的
blockHandler
属性来指定配置规则的兜底方法。第三
Demo_Null
·
2022-12-28 11:33
Spring
Cloud
java
spring
boot
spring
cloud
spring
cloud
alibaba
后端
SpringCloud Alibaba-Sentinel
流控效果四、Sentinel熔断降级1、简述2、熔断策略五、Sentinel热点限流规则1、热点规则2、参数例外项六、Sentinel系统规则七、@SentinelResource1、简述2、value3、
blockHandler
4
sakanal
·
2022-12-26 16:13
spring
cloud
SpringCloud Sentinel 使用restTemplate的两种配置介绍
blockHandler
:降级的处理方法名,默认在当前类中匹配。如果指定了blockHandlerClass(降级处理的类名),则在指定类中匹配。
liuhenghui5201
·
2022-11-25 15:37
SpringCloud
sentinel
【微服务sentinel】 控制台 dashboard 安装部署
项目配置2.2springcloud配置3.触发客户端初始化参考相关文章:【Sentinel入门】01最简单的例子helloworld【Sentinel入门】02@SentinelResource语法(
blockHandler
云川之下
·
2022-11-06 07:20
spring
cloud
控制台
sentinel
dashboard
sentinel源码解析
1、@SentinelResource注解解析这里需要注意点的:1、fallback和
blockHandler
的区别,前者是方法异常就会执行的方法,后者是熔断后才会执行
白菜404
·
2022-07-25 22:34
spring cloud/sentinel
dashboard)独立运行sentinel功能:服务限流、热点限流、降级熔断、系统规则@SentinelResource(value=“fallback”,fallback=“handlerFallback”,
blockHandler
xcrj
·
2022-07-22 10:49
spring-cloud
spring
cloud
sentinel
java
微服务 springcloudAlibab之Sentinel 系统规则 自定义限流
@SentinelResource资源限流定义:使用了@SentinelResource注解的
blockHandler
属性,定义出现限流效果的属性编写测试类packagecom.gek.cloudalibabasentinelservice8401
高码农
·
2022-07-07 07:59
微服务
java
架构
sentinel配置
blockHandler
为什么不生效?
测试的http://localhost:8080/user/hello可以生效,但是使用@SentinelResouce注解http://locahost:8080/user/getUser?id=1为什么不生效呢?不能进入blockHandlerForGetUser方法跟着别人的视频看的,后来通过官网文档查看,原来是少配置:加上下边的配置,就完美解决了
大HHH山
·
2021-07-11 14:10
springcloud alibaba——sentinel@sentinelResource注解中的
blockHandler
与fallback
@sentinelResource注解中存在
blockHandler
与fallback这两个相似的属性,其中
blockHandler
属性处理的是通过sentinel控制台来配置的属性(如流控、热点等等)
weixin_43925059
·
2020-09-12 12:49
Sentinel 自定义兜底逻辑
如果请求失败效果如下这种错误提示不太友好,此时可以自定义兜底逻辑@SentinelResource注解类似于Hystrix中的@HystrixCommand注解@SentinelResource注解中有两个属性需要我们进行区分,
blockHandler
四月丶丶
·
2020-09-12 09:09
Sentinel
Sentinel
SentinelResource注解限流
@SentinelResource(value="helloAnother",
blockHandler
=="defaultFallback")使用注解限流,只需要将上述注解加在被限流的方法上,如:@SentinelResource
Consck
·
2020-08-25 08:19
JDK Proxy与UndeclaredThrowableException不可不说的关系
背景最近浏览Sentinel的wiki,其中有一段描述:特别地,若
blockHandler
和fallback都进行了配置,则被限流降级而抛出BlockException时只会进入
blockHandler
神的力量
·
2020-08-19 18:11
java
SpringCloudAlibaba——编码方式配置Sentinel限流与熔断
熔断的实现流程定义资源定义限流、熔断规则检验规则是否生效定义资源方式一:使用@SentinelResource注解@GetMapping("testY")@SentinelResource(value="testY",
blockHandler
吴声子夜歌
·
2020-08-17 21:25
Sentinel
Spring Cloud Alibaba(五)简单接入Sentinel(
blockHandler
用法)
在SpringCloudAlibaba(四)简单接入Sentinel(fallback用法)中,简单的尝试了一下fallback的用法,下面看一下
blockHandler
的用法,先看说明:
blockHandler
阿琪琪琪
·
2020-08-14 15:18
Spring
Cloud
Alibaba
springCloud搭建分布式微服务学习--10--Sentinel服务熔断(整合ribbon,openFeign,fallback)
nacos等,通过一个小demo来串联知识业务需求:创建两个服务提供者nacos9001,nacos9002,一个消费者nacosOrder,在nacosOrder中配置sentinel指定fallback和
blockHandler
zisuu
·
2020-07-14 00:39
springCloud
Spring Cloud gateway 七 Sentinel 注解方式使用
@SentinelResource注解包含以下属性:value:资源名称,必需项(不能为空)entryType:entry类型,可选项(默认为EntryType.OUT)
blockHandler
/blockHandlerClass
昨日_1989
·
2020-07-11 17:25
spring
spring
boot
spring
cloud
程序员,你知道Sentinel限流、降级的统一处理吗?
前言之前老顾介绍了sentinel的fallback、
blockhandler
;不知道小伙伴们有没有注意到一个问题?老顾带着大家来看看。问题一sentinel的默认流控返回的是:1.
EnjoyEDU
·
2020-07-10 16:08
编程人生
编程语言
Java
java
spring
servlet
vue
javascript
从零开始SpringCloud Alibaba电商系统(四)——Sentinel的fallback和
blockHandler
文章目录零、系列一、什么是fallback和
blockHandler
?
落在地上的乐乐
·
2020-06-25 10:21
alibaba
[学习笔记]Spring Cloud Alibaba详细教程
DataIDGroupNameSpaceNacos高可用集群配置MySQL数据库Nacos集群配置配置NginxSentinel流量控制与熔断流控规则降级规则热点限流规则系统规则SentinelResource配置
blockHandler
孛尔只斤
·
2020-06-21 00:19
有时候会搞乱的
blockHandler
与fallback
前言之前老顾介绍了sentinel的降级熔断文章,有些小伙伴在使用的过程中对
blockhandler
和fallback的使用会搞乱,这里老顾在这里在继续强化一下他们的区别以及使用。
EnjoyEDU
·
2020-06-20 22:59
编程人生
编程语言
Java
Spring Cloud gateway 七 Sentinel 注解方式使用
@SentinelResource注解包含以下属性:value:资源名称,必需项(不能为空)entryType:entry类型,可选项(默认为EntryType.OUT)
blockHandler
/blockHandlerClass
程序猿弟弟
·
2020-04-13 20:45
Sentinel-结合RestTemplate(四)
org.springframework.cloudspring-cloud-commonsorg.springframework.cloudspring-cloud-alibaba-sentinel配置注入:@Bean@LoadBalanced//让RestTemplate支持Sentinel限流@SentinelRestTemplate(
blockHandler
lxhllf2005
·
2019-11-20 18:01
sentinel
resttemplate
微服务-Alibaba
上一页
1
2
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他